What are the main differences between tofu and lentil? Tofu is richer in calcium, manganese, selenium, and copper, yet lentil is richer in folate, fiber, vitamin B5, iron, and vitamin B6. Tofu's daily need coverage for calcium is 66% higher. Tofu has 24 times more saturated fat than lentil. Tofu has 1.261g of saturated fat, while lentil has 0.053g. Tofu has a lower glycemic index than lentil. We used Tofu, raw, firm, prepared with calcium sulfate and Lentils, mature seeds, cooked, boiled, without salt types in this comparison.
